Viking 38 Billfish specs
Detailed Specifications | Values |
---|---|
Drinking Water Tank | 261 L / (69 gal) |
Gas Tank Size | 1741 L / (460 gal) |
Dimensions And Weight | |
Beam Width | 4.27 Meters / (13 feet and 12 inches) |
Dry Weight (Empty) | 14040 Kg / (30953 lb) |
LOA (Length Overall) | 11.79 Meters / (38 feet and 8 inches) |
Minimum Draft | 1.02 Meters / (3 feet and 4 inches) |
Engine and Power Specs | |
Engine Drive | Direct Drive |
Engine Horsepower | 410 kW / (550 hp) |
Engine Location | Inboard |
Engine Series | QSB6.7 |
Engine Manufacturer | Cummins |

General Data about Viking 38 Billfish | |
Boat Type | Power |
Brand | Viking |
Category | Convertible |
Condition (New/Used) | New |
Country | Michigan |
Fuel (Gas/Diesel) | Diesel |
Hull Material Used | Fiberglass |
Length | 11.58 m / (38.00 ft) |
Model | 38 Billfish |
Selling Price | Set price |
Year Of Production | 2021 |
